FC Goa go down fighting to Salgaocar FC in GFA President’s Super League!

The FC Goa Development Team went down fighting against Salgaocar FC in the GFA President’s Super League at the Salvador do Mundo Panchayat Ground on Sunday. Salgeo Dias opened the scoring for the Gaurs, but an own-goal by Kunal Kundaikar and a penalty goal by Samuel Costa helped Salgaocar script a remarkable comeback victory.

FC Goa Development Team head coach Deggie Cardozo changed his entire starting XI on Sunday, as Manushawn Fernandes, Danstan Fernandes and Delton Colaco among others returned to the playing XI. Among them, Colaco’s stint was short-lived as the forward had to be subbed off due to injury in the 19th minute.

The Gaurs broke the deadlock in the 39th minute. Vasim Inamdar played a beautiful through ball into the opponents’ box and it was youngster Salgeo who connected, firing his shot past their goalkeeper and into the bottom corner. Their joy, however, lasted for just three minutes as they themselves gifted the opponents the equaliser in a rather unfortunate fashion.

Kundaikar’s backward pass caught Hansel Coelho off guard and the Goa goalkeeper was in no position to make a save as the ball flew into the back of the net meaning the teams would head into half-time with the score reading 1-1.

Deggie Cardozo’s boys adopted a cautious approach in the second half, trying to hold on to the ball and thereby control the tempo of the match. Salgaocar, however, countered it effectively with heavy pressing and forced them into mistakes.

That, along with a lack of cohesion in midfield and attack proved costly for FC Goa, as they failed to create an impact in the opponents’ half for the rest of the match.

Salgaocar, made FC Goa pay for their lack of penetration when they completed their comeback in the 82nd minute when Samuel scored the winner from the spot. Although Goa shot-stopper Hansel guessed correctly and timed his jump well, the youngster’s shot was too hot for him to handle.

The FC Goa Dev Team will return to action on Wednesday, May 4, when they lock horns with Kerala Blasters FC in the Reliance Foundation Development League. The game is slated for a 4:30pm kickoff at the Benaulim Panchayat Ground.
